The Greyhound Bus schedule from Miami, Florida to Key West Florida indicates there are 2 different departure times. There is a 12:05 PM departure which arrives in Key West at 4:35 PM. There is also a later departure at 5:45 PM which arrives in Key West at 10:15 PM.

To see a guide demonstrating all the Express courses and centers, voyagers visit Greyhound.com, select Services and Routes, click on Greyhound Express and tap on Route Map. Express courses are appeared in orange and normal Greyhound transport courses are appeared in blue. Voyagers wishing to book a seat on an Express administration visit the Greyhound.com landing page and enter their excursion subtle elements in the Tickets box. On the off chance that an Express administration is accessible for the picked course, the "e" logo shows up underneath the voyage time on the rundown of takeoffs. Explorers can look at the costs of Express administration tickets with customary Greyhound transport tickets, and tap on +Schedule Details under every takeoff time to see the quantity of stops, length of any delays and exchange data. A portion of the benefits of going with the Express administration are less stops, quicker excursion times, ensured seating, additional legroom, electrical plugs and free Wi-Fi.
